Which of the following best describes why Okazaki fragments are not observed in PCR?
A. DNA primase is used for the entire reaction therefore eliminating the production of Okazaki fragments that normally result from the activity of DNA polymerase.
B. DNA ligase is added to the reaction to form the phosphodiester bond among the oligonucleotide primers and the short newly synthesized fragments - on an electrophoresis gel this looks like a long continuous fragment.
C. DNA polymerase has been genetically changed to read the template strands in either the 3' to 5' or the 5' to 3' direction thus allowing for the enzyme to follow the replication fork irrespective of the strand.
D. The DNA template is completely denatured by near boiling temperatures and the oligonucleotide primers anneal to the ends of the fragment that is to be amplified therefore allowing for DNA polymerase to synthesize the new strands in long continuous stretches.
